January 6, 2026 Opinion or Order Filing 3 ORDER FILED. The court consolidates appeal Nos. 25-5155 and 25-8161. The court grants an extension of time to respond to the November 24, 2025 order entered in appeal No. 25-5155. On or before February 20, 2026, appellant must: (1) file a statement explaining why the consolidated appeals are not frivolous and a motion to proceed in forma pauperis, OR (2) file a motion to voluntarily dismiss the appeals, see Fed. R. App. P. 42(b). If appellant files a statement explaining why the consolidated appeals are not frivolous, or any other response other than a motion to dismiss, the court will determine whether the appeals are frivolous. If they are frivolous, the appeals will be dismissed. If they are not frivolous, the appeals will proceed. If appellant files a statement that the appeals should go forward, appellees may file a response within 10 days after service of appellants statement. Briefing is stayed. If appellant does not respond to this order, the court may dismiss the consolidated appeals without further notice. The clerk will serve on appellant: (1) a form motion to voluntarily dismiss the appeal, (2) a form statement that the appeal should go forward, and (3) a Form 4 financial affidavit.
